Tech analysis: How Ferrari caught up with Red Bull in Japan

Ferrari was certainly the most proactive of the leading Formula 1 teams in Japan, with the SF16-H treated to a multitude of parts to improve performance. Having found itself off kilter to Red Bull during the middle of the season, the team has chosen to revive its 2016 programme and chase down its opposition rather than simply turn their full attention to 2017. It's an interesting path to take considering it is running two other programmes in tandem, working on the Pirelli test mule and the 2017 car.
